CQ_(7)_[TACHIMETER] v2 — USER MANUAL
© CQuevedo345
Pine Script v6 | TradingView Indicator
================================================================================
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
WHAT IT DOES
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
The Tachimeter is a real-time momentum speed gauge displayed as a table overlay
on your TradingView chart. It measures how fast price is moving by comparing the
current close to the close of the previous 20-minute bar (RPM = price delta).
The result is visualized as two emoji-based bar gauges — similar to a rev counter
on a car dashboard — that fill up as momentum increases. A label describes the
strength of the move in plain English, and the current price is shown with a
colored background that reflects the current trend direction.
The indicator is LIVE-ONLY: it only renders during real-time bars and hides on
historical bars to avoid repainting.
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
KEY CONCEPTS
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
RPM (Rate of Price Movement)
RPM = Current Close minus Close of the previous 20-minute bar.
Positive RPM = bullish momentum. Negative RPM = bearish momentum.
The absolute value of RPM drives how many blocks fill up on the gauges.
Daily Tendency
Compares current close to the daily open.
Close >= Daily Open → Bullish (teal header/footer)
Close < Daily Open → Bearish (red header/footer)
Bull / Bear (RPM Tendency)
Determined by whether RPM is positive or negative.
Drives gauge square colors, overdrive colors, and price cell background.

THE GAUGES
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
Two 13-block bar gauges are shown stacked:
X10 Bar (top gauge)
One block lights up per 10 RPM, up to a maximum of 10 blocks (100 RPM).
If |RPM| reaches 101 or above, all 13 blocks fill instantly — indicating
the move has gone into overdrive range.
X100 Bar (bottom gauge)
Only activates when |RPM| >= 101.
Each block represents 100 RPM of additional momentum beyond the first 100.
Blocks 1–10 use the primary color. Blocks 11–13 use the overdrive color,
signaling extreme momentum.
X100 Block Mapping:
101–199 → 1 block
200–299 → 2 blocks
300–399 → 3 blocks
400–499 → 4 blocks
500–599 → 5 blocks
600–699 → 6 blocks
700–799 → 7 blocks
800–899 → 8 blocks
900–999 → 9 blocks
1000–1099 → 10 blocks
1100–1199 → 11 blocks (overdrive zone begins)
1200–1299 → 12 blocks
1300+ → 13 blocks

ACCELERATION LABELS
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
A text label below the title describes the strength of the current move.
The label applies to both bullish and bearish directions equally.
|RPM| 0 – 9 → S T O P P E D
|RPM| 10 – 100 → I D L I N G
|RPM| 101 – 199 → E X T R E M E L Y W E A K
|RPM| 200 – 299 → V E R Y W E A K
|RPM| 300 – 399 → W E A K
|RPM| 400 – 499 → M O S T L Y W E A K
|RPM| 500 – 599 → S O M E W H A T W E A K
|RPM| 600 – 699 → M O D E R A T E L Y W E A K
|RPM| 700 – 799 → M O D E R A T E
|RPM| 800 – 899 → M O D E R A T E L Y S T R O N G
|RPM| 900 – 999 → M O S T L Y S T R O N G
|RPM| 1000 – 1099 → S T R O N G
|RPM| 1100 – 1199 → V E R Y S T R O N G
|RPM| 1200 – 1299 → E X C E P T I O N A L L Y S T R O N G
|RPM| 1300+ → U L T R A S T R O N G

TABLE LAYOUT
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
The dashboard is a 5-column × 5-row table. Here is what each cell displays:
Row 0, Cols 0–2 (merged) → Title: "T A C H I M E T E R" in Rounded font
Background: teal (bullish) or red (bearish)
based on daily open vs. close.
Row 0, Col 3 → Acceleration label (strength of move in text).
Same background color as the title.
Row 1, Col 0 → Scale labels: "X10" and "X100"
Row 1, Col 1 → The gauge display:
Scale ruler (⏒ tick marks)
X10 bar (13 emoji blocks)
Number scale (₂ ₄ ₆ ₈ ₁₀ ₁₁ ₁₂ ₁₃)
X100 bar (13 emoji blocks)
Scale ruler (⏒ tick marks)
Row 1, Col 2 → Raw RPM value (formatted as a 2-digit number).
Row 1, Col 3 → Current price + tendency dot (🟢 or 🔴).
Background: teal (bull) or red (bear) at 50%
transparency, based on RPM tendency.

COLOR GUIDE
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
Gauge squares — Trend Color mode (default):
🟩 Bullish fill (X10 and X100 bars, blocks 1–10)
🟦 Bullish overdrive (X100 bar, blocks 11–13)
🟥 Bearish fill (X10 and X100 bars, blocks 1–10)
🟨 Bearish overdrive (X100 bar, blocks 11–13)
⬛ Empty block
Gauge squares — White mode:
⬜ All active blocks (both bars, all slots)
⬛ Empty block
Tendency dot (price cell):
🟢 RPM is positive (bullish)
🔴 RPM is negative (bearish)
Header / Acceleration cell background:
Teal → Close >= Daily Open
Red → Close < Daily Open
Price cell background:
Teal at 50% transparency → RPM bullish
Red at 50% transparency → RPM bearish

SETTINGS & INPUTS
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
Group: PRICE LABELS
Show Current Price and Tachimeter (toggle, default: ON)
Master on/off switch. When disabled, the entire table is hidden.
Group: EMA Dashboard
Dashboard Position (dropdown, default: Top Center)
Controls where the table is anchored on the chart.
Options: Bottom Left, Top Center, Middle Left, Middle Right,
Bottom Right, Top Right.
Dashboard Size (dropdown, default: Tiny)
Controls the text size of the gauge content.
Options: Auto, Tiny, Small, Normal, Large, Huge.
Recommendation: Tiny for mobile, Small for desktop browser.
Group: GAUGE STYLE
Gauge Square Color Mode (dropdown, default: Trend Color)
Trend Color (Green/Red): squares reflect bull/bear direction.
White: all active squares display as white (⬜) regardless of direction.
Useful for minimalist or light-theme charts.

IMPORTANT NOTES
────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
- The indicator renders ONLY on real-time, unconfirmed bars. It will not
display on historical bars. This is by design to prevent repainting.
- RPM is measured against the 20-minute timeframe close[1], making it most
meaningful on intraday charts (1m, 3m, 5m, 15m, etc.).
- On slower timeframes (Daily, Weekly) the RPM values will be very large
and the X100 bar will almost always be fully lit. The indicator is
optimized for intraday use.
- The weekly_open and monthly_open security calls are fetched but currently
reserved for future use. They do not affect the current display.
